SL Cycles: Overlapping contours
Pockets and islands can be overlapped to form a new contour. The area
of a pocket can thus be enlarged by another pocket or reduced by an
island.
Starting position
Machining begins at the starting position of the first pocket in Cycle 14
CONTOUR GEOMETRY. The starting position should be located as far
as possible from the overlapping contours.
F g. 8.42: Example of overlapping contours
Example: Overlapping pockets
Machining begins with the first contour label defined in block 6. The first
pocket must begin outside the second pocket.
